Flo update















We have received word from Paul and Martha and all are well. Praise God! Here is the email from Paul this morning along with some photos.

"Power was knocked out around 3:30 AM on Monday, and restored this evening around 8 PM. Although we had hurricane force winds and fairly high waves, damage at Cloverdale and around the island was minimal. Businesses reopened today and schools will reopen tomorrow (Wednesday). Ants have also emerged from hiding by the thousands, as they usually do after a storm. Here's what the storm looked like from our living room..."
